Answer to Question 1

Ideally a team would have skilled members, all of whom could monitor the group's actions at all times. Any member might see a problem that needs to be addressed and decide to take an action. Such shared leadership would be particularly helpful in a team that has internal task and relational problems as well as external problems. The team leader might not be able to address all of the problems simultaneously. For example, team members might intervene internally to improve interpersonal problems while the leader focuses on intervening on the task issue. And together the leader and members could focus on dealing with the external problems. Team leaders do not always accurately diagnose team problems, and having team members also monitoring and taking requisite action can lead to greater effectiveness.
